Product Description
DOWSIL™ X3-6211 Encapsulant is a one-part, clear, ultraviolet-curing silicone gel encapsulant for very fast processing of relatively flat and less complicated printed circuit-board assemblies. The ready-to-use material requires no mixing and has a typical viscosity of 925 cP, allowing flow across uncomplicated board geometry before UV exposure. It reaches 90% of gel hardness in approximately five seconds at an energy dose above 3,000 mJ/cm². After cure, the soft gel retains flexibility at very low temperatures and provides stress relief, electrical insulation, and a typical refractive index of 1.41.

Additional Information
As-supplied / before-processing properties
Typical as-supplied or processing-state values unless otherwise stated. These values are not sales specifications.
| Property | Value | Unit | Method / condition |
|---|---|---|---|
| Product form | One-part UV-curing gel | N/A | As supplied |
| Color | Clear | N/A | As supplied |
| Viscosity | 925 | cP | Typical |
| UV cure time | 5 | s | To 90% gel hardness at >3,000 mJ/cm² |
| Shelf life | 12 | months | At 25°C |
After-processing / final-state properties
Typical cured, installed, or in-use values under the stated conditions. These values are not sales specifications.
| Property | Value | Unit | Method / condition |
|---|---|---|---|
| Gel hardness | 105 | g | Typical cured value |
| Penetration | 50 | 0.1 mm | Typical cured value |
| Refractive index | 1.41 | N/A | Typical cured value |
| Dielectric strength | 17 | kV/mm | Typical cured value |
